Pharmacy Law Symposium
March 2010June 2010 & October 2010
This program is designed to assist pharmacists, pharmacy students, attorneys and other interested parties in understanding the laws and rules that affect the practice of pharmacy in Texas. The curriculum is aimed at providing pharmacy professionals with a better understanding of Texas and federal drug laws. Students & reciprocating pharmacists should take this program to prepare for the state pharmacy law exam.

Pharmacy-Based Immunization Delivery
July 2010September 2010

Pharmacy-Based Immunization Delivery is an innovative interactive training program that provides pharmacy professionals the skills necessary to become a primary source for vaccination information and administration. The program teaches the basics of immunology and focuses on practice implementation and legal/regulatory issues while providing hands-on injection training.

PRN Seminars
The Professional Recovery Network (PRN) was established by TPA to provide support and training to pharmacy and dental professionals. PRN classes present topics on drug and alcohol abuse and addiction. These interactive sessions will help participants better understand the issues and provide support for those affected by substance abuse problems.

Rxperts Leadership Institute
This weekend seminar is focused on developing the leadership skills of pharmacy professionals who have been out of school for 10 years or less. The learning opportunity is limited to 20 pharmacists nominated by their peers and is conducted by Texas business leaders, pharmacists and industry experts.

Texas Health Steps Online Provider Education
Health Steps CE is provided at no charge by the Texas Department of Health Servics and consists of self-paced, web-based training modules. Each module is divided into sections, with an evaluation component following each section. An online certificate of completion will be issued after a trainee successfully completes an entire module. These modules are also available in PowerPoint® versions for use in training conducted in classroom settings and as printed collateral materials.

Current CE classifications include Cultural Competence, Immunization and Pharmacy.

The Texas Health and Human Services Commission has a series of computer-based training opportunities for pharmacies to educate staff about Medicaid pharmacy benefits (particularly for children under 21) and how to get reimbursed.  This course is accredited by ACPE.
